Foretellix Integrates Safety and Validation Toolchain with NVIDIA DRIVE AV Platform
In an exciting development for the autonomous vehicle industry, Foretellix has announced the integration of its innovative Foretify Physical AI toolchain with NVIDIA's DRIVE AV platform. This collaboration aims to enhance the training, testing, validation, and safety evaluation processes integral to the development of autonomous vehicles. By combining Foretellix's cutting-edge verification and validation capabilities with NVIDIA's comprehensive software stack, this partnership is set to significantly advance the industry's efforts towards achieving safer levels of autonomy, specifically L2++, L3, and L4.
A Milestone in Technology Integration
The collaboration marks an important milestone in the relationship between Foretellix and NVIDIA, a relationship that initially began when NVIDIA invested in Foretellix's Series C funding. Through this partnership, both companies have worked closely to blend their respective technologies, particularly integrating tools such as NVIDIA Omniverse and NVIDIA Cosmos into the Foretify toolchain.
Foretellix stands as a leader in Physical AI toolchain solutions, providing a suite of tools that facilitates inclusive safety evaluations, coverage-driven verification, and synthetic data generation for the training, testing, and validation of autonomous vehicle systems. The Foretellix toolchain is designed to simulate a vast array of realistic driving environments, helping developers to assess AI performance and safety during vehicle development.
One of the standout features of the Foretellix toolchain is its ability to identify performance gaps and safety concerns in autonomous driving scenarios, enabling developers to create targeted scenarios to address these issues effectively. This structured evaluation process is crucial for ensuring that the deployment of AI in real-world settings is as safe as possible.
Collaborative Efforts Toward a Safer Future
Ziv Binyamini, CEO and Co-Founder of Foretellix, emphasized the importance of safety in the evolution of Physical AI. He stated, “Safety will define the future of Physical AI. We are excited to collaborate with NVIDIA on this mission to make the DRIVE AV end-to-end stack safe by jointly working on the training, validation, evaluation, and coverage essential for large-scale, real-world deployment.”
From NVIDIA’s perspective, Xinzhou Wu, Vice President of Automotive, articulated the benefits of the integration: “Our collaboration with Foretellix integrates complementary technologies to strengthen the safety foundation of the autonomous vehicle industry. By combining the NVIDIA DRIVE AV end-to-end stack with Foretellix’s Physical AI toolchain for large-scale, scenario-based validation, we’re helping advance industry-wide standards for transparency, robustness, and safety. Together, we’re enabling NVIDIA developers to design, test, and safely deploy AI-powered vehicles with greater confidence and scale.”
